Abstract
An 80-year-old man was diagnosed with acute myeloid leukemia (AML), and molecular analysis identified FLT3-ITD, TKD mutations. Induction chemotherapy with daunorubicin plus cytarabine achieved hematological complete remission; however, extramedullary infiltration was detected in the skin and central nervous system. Due to this extramedullary disease, treatment with mitoxantrone plus high-dose cytarabine was administered, leading to systemic complete remission. Two cycles of the same regimen were then added. The patient relapsed 5 months later, at which time FLT3 mutations were no longer detectable by a companion diagnostic test. However, targeted sequencing analysis identified a novel FLT3-ITD positive minor clone. Treatment with venetoclax plus azacitidine was then started. The patient achieved complete remission and has remained relapse-free for more than 2 years. In this case, the FLT3 mutation companion diagnostic test result became spontaneously negative without FLT3-directed treatment, and the response to venetoclax plus azacitidine was favorable. This case highlights the importance of molecular testing not only at diagnosis but also at relapse for appropriate treatment selection.
